LED ZEPPELIN--- LED ZEPPELIN ---Genuine, Original UK 1st Pressing Stereo With Turquoise Sleeve Text and Red/Plum Superhype Labels.
In Lovely Condition From 1969 With Uncorrected Matrices This is an original UK 1st pressed copy from 1969 in stereo on the Red/Plum Atlantic Superhype label, cat.
no.
588171 with A//1 and B//1 matrices.
only the very first pressings have the UNCORRECTED matrices.
All susequent issues have the second 8 crossed out and re-etched above.
